The story of Tee
Tee is not currently in use for newborns in the United States — fewer than five babies received the name in 2025. Its story lives in the historical record below.
Since 1910, 458 American babies have been named Tee — about 89% boys and 11% girls, making it a genuinely unisex name. Its peak came in 1982, when 16 newborns received the name — the signature sound of the 1980s.
